Iced Earth started off in the mid-80s as Purgatory, a name Jon Schaffer chose to symbolize his vision of a band that could deliver both music and lyrics with meaning and depth. In 1988, Purgatory became Iced Earth, a name inspired by the frozen wastelands of Jon Schaffer’s heritage in Indiana. Iced Earth's sound is heavily influenced by traditional heavy metal greats like Iron Maiden and Judas Priest, as well as classic hard rock bands like Led Zeppelin and Black Sabbath.
One of the group's most successful albums is Horror Show, which hit the shelves in 2001. With lyrics that focused on spooky tales like Jack the Ripper, Damien, and Frankenstein, the album was precisely the kind of thematic record Iced Earth had been working towards. Songs like Dracula, Damien, and the operatic The Phantom Opera Ghost have since become fan favorites. The same can be said for the album Something Wicked This Way Comes, which has also been significant for Iced Earth.
One of Iced Earth's most notable tracks is Watching Over Me. It's a stunningly beautiful ballad that was written in honor of Jon Schaffer's childhood friend who had passed away. It's an emotionally charged track that's become a fan and live show favorite, highlighting Schaffer's incredible songwriting abilities. Another Iced Earth classic is the epic Dante's Inferno, which, as the title suggests, is based on the first part of Dante Alighieri's Divine Comedy. The song clocks in at over 16 minutes and showcases Iced Earth's ability to create music that's both complex and catchy.
Iced Earth has been known as a power metal band that has fused various metal styles. Their music has a lot of progressive and thrash metal elements, which are subtly woven into their sound. The band has been able to create a niche for themselves through their ability to create music that's both hard-hitting and thought-provoking. This has been highlighted by their most recent album Incorruptible, which sees the band delivering a modern take on their classic sound.
